TVL Group invests in bigger headquarters

TVL Group has unveiled its expanded company headquarters in Brentwood, Essex, which will enhance its operational capabilities and enable sustainable business growth.

TVL’s expanded headquarters will enhance its operational capabilities and enable sustainable business growth

The vehicle security and innovation expert has invested in additional working space and storage capacity, while also reintegrating its ProtectAVan specialist installation arm into the central site at the Horndon Industrial Park.

TVL Group’s flagship facility now boasts a substantially larger yard – a huge 35% increase on the previous site – and 20,000 sq ft of additional warehouse capacity to stock more parts and products. The total investment sees its headquarters now span 112,731 sq ft.

The move, in particular, will maximise the efficiency of the ProtectAVan team, especially due to the decision to install a new vehicle compound capable of holding more than 200 vans at any one moment. This means ProtectAVan can efficiently accommodate much larger orders and complete conversions much quicker, boosting overall customer service.

The decision to welcome ProtectAVan back after it moved to a larger unit away from the estate in 2017 also means it shares a common workspace with TVL Security, TVL Finishing and TVL Manufacturing. This will allow for internal expertise to be shared much more easily, fostering innovation while accelerating product development. ProtectAVan will also retain its sites in Loughborough and Swindon.

Laura Moran, managing director of TVL Group, said: “This investment in the TVL Group headquarters marks an exciting new chapter for us, with the move meaning we can now work together much more closely and share ideas and resources with ease.

“In today’s climate, robust vehicle security is more important than ever before. This expansion underscores our commitment to providing as many customers as possible with quick and easy access to affordable and effective solutions, positioning TVL Group at the forefront of innovation in our sector.”
